1729-1733 Richmond County, Virginia Deed Book 8; Part 4 [Antient Press]; Page 674]
THIS INDENTURE made the Seventh day of Febry: in the Seaventh year of the Reigne of our Sovereigne Lord George by the grace of God of Great Britain France & Ireland, King, Defender of the faith &c., Annoq: Domini one thousand seaven hundred thirty three & four; Between NATHANIELL MASON of Parish of Northfarnham in County of Richmd., Carpenter, & HANNAH his Wife of one part & WILLIAM DOWNMAN, JUNR, of abovesaid Parish & County, Gentleman, of other part; Witnesseth that NATHANIELL MASON & HANNAH his Wife in consideration of Forty two pounds Sterling money & Five thousand pounds of lawfull tobacco, one Feather Bedd, boulster rugg blanket, one pier of sheets to NATHANIELL MASON & HANNAH his Wife by WILLIAM DOWNMAN, JUNR. in hand paid, the receipt whereof NATHANIELL MASON & HANNAH his Wife doe hereby acknowledge, have & doe by these presents bargain & sell unto WILLIAM DOWNMAN his heirs one certain tract of land scituate in Parish of Northfarnham in County of Richmond containing Two hundred & fifty acres of land more or less, part of a Patent of Six hundred acres of land formerly granted to THOMAS STEPHENS dated ye twelfth of February 1652, which land lyes in Northfarnham Parish in County of Richmond on North side of MORATTICO CREEK, bounded W. by S. against the land formerly NICHOLAS FERMENs, S. & by E. upon MORATTICO CREEK, E. & by N. upon a Branch of MORATTICO CREEK. N. & by W. into the woods which said Six hundred acres of land descended to NATHANIEL CALE, Grand Son of THOMS: STEPHENS & by the Last Will & Testament of abovesd. NATHANIEL in Writing devised Two hundred & fifty acres of the above mentioned six hundd. acres of land to his the said NATHANIEL CALEs Sister, ELIZABETH KING. & said ELIZABETH KING dying without Will or conveying ye said Two hundred & fifty acres of land to any person, descended to her, the said ELIZABETH's Son, NATHANIEL MASON, heir at Law to his the said NATHANIEL MASON Mother, ELIZABETH MASON. To have & to hold the Two hundred & fifty acres of land with all houses tobacco houses profits & appurtenances in any ways appertaining unto WILLIAM DOWNMAN, JUNR his heirs; And NATHANIEL MASON and HANNAH his Wife & their heirs the land & premises unto WILLIAM DOWNMAN, JUNR, his heirs against the lawfull claime of all persons shall warrant & for ever defend discharged from all manner of incumbrances except the Quitrents which shall henceforth grow due; In Witness of all which the parties abovesaid to these p:sents interchangeably sett their hands & seales on the day
& year above written
Sign'd Seal'd & Delivered in p:sence of us
RAWLEIGH CHINN, SENR. NATHANIEL MASON
WILLIAM ARSKIEN HANNAH MASON
TOBIAS PHILLIPS
LUKE STOTT. THIDLEY DENNEHAM
February ye 3d. day 1733/4
Mimmorandum; That this day Livery of Seizen & possession of the within mentioned Two hundred & fifty acres of land was made & given by the within named NATHANIEL MASON & HANNAH his Wife by Turff Twigg in token of possession & seizen of the land according to the tenor of ye within Deed in p:sence of us
RAWLEIGH CHINN, SENR.
TOBIAS PHILLIPS DUDLEY BENEHAM WILLIAM ARSKIEN, LUKE STOTT,
